## Releases

Welcome aboard! Quieten, our on-call alert deduplicator, ships every other Thursday. We cut a tag from main, run the smoke suite against the Farwick staging cluster, and push artifacts to the internal registry. If you're doing the release, ping whoever's on rotation first — usually Marla or Deet — so nobody double-cuts. Hotfixes skip the schedule but still need a signed build; unsigned tarballs get rejected at deploy time, no exceptions. To verify any release artifact locally, use the current signing key below.

signing key of yagug-bawif = bky9_cvCf6ehGp

The Orvane Labs bike cage and the east and west parking gates operate on separate access schedules, and facilities desk staff should note that visitor vehicles may only use the west gate between 07:00 and 19:00. Cyclists requesting cage access must show a valid day pass, and their details should be entered in the access ledger before the cage is opened. Gates must never be propped open, even briefly, during deliveries. When a manual override is required at either gate, use the code below.

staff pass of fadup-fawig = bdg-FUNKS-4

Ticket #4482 — Validator plugin registry dropping connections

Hey, welcome aboard! Quick one for you. The Fenwick plugin system for data validators keeps losing its handle to the registry DB — plugins load fine, then health checks start failing about ten minutes in. Marla thinks it's pool exhaustion because each plugin opens its own session instead of sharing. Can you reproduce locally and confirm? Use the staging Brindle cluster, not prod. To connect, point your validator host at the string below.

primary connection of yagep-kahip = redis://giliel_svc:zYiKsLL2PLpfPL@db-348f.xolmarsys.corp:5432/fenwyn

Plugin authors: Ledgerline converts all amounts to minor units before arithmetic. Rounding happens exactly once, at display time, using banker's rounding. Plugins that round intermediate values will drift from core totals and fail certification. Conversions through a pivot currency accumulate error bounded by the constants below; stay within them or reconciliation in Brastow's settlement step will reject your batch. Certification tests enforce these limits.

tuning constants:
TIERS = {
    "sorion": 670,
    "istax": 547,
}